Current Care Standards


The home retains a ‘Good’ rating, carried over from its most recent inspection in February 2019, across the key care criteria: safe, responsive, well-led, effective and caring. Although the registration changed in 2022, Bluebell House upholds its former provider’s status.


Licensed to support up to 20 residents, Bluebell House does not offer medical nursing services.
